Bye before Showdown could favor KU
Kansas University’s football team is trying to downplay the whole scenario. But history presents repeated evidence that the Jayhawks are benefiting from a fortunate scheduling quirk yet again. Kansas has this week off before playing rival Kansas State on Oct. 6 in Manhattan. K-State, meanwhile, has a little distraction this Saturday called the Texas Longhorns.

KU Boot Camp ‘off to a good start’
Kansas University’s 17 men’s basketball players walked through the northwest tunnel of Allen Fieldhouse onto James Naismith Court at 6 a.m. Monday - one hour and 10 minutes before sunrise. Everybody on the roster was present and accounted for for the squad’s first Boot Camp conditioning workout of the 2007-08 preseason.
